[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#463159: XCB-enabled libx11 causes hangs in various X clients



Package: libx11-6
Version: 2:1.1.3-1
Severity: critical

This is only 'critical' because it causes unrelated software (e.g., Side
Effects Software's Houdini) to break by causing hangs. Feel free to
downgrade, but this is a very important bug to me, at least.

This is also reported upstream:
http://bugs.freedesktop.org/show_bug.cgi?id=9528

Simply upgrading to a XCB-enabled libx11 build causes clients to start
hanging inside _XReply. There is a bunch of analysis at
http://lists.freedesktop.org/archives/xcb/2007-August/002961.html too.

To reproduce, download a build of Houdini 9.0 from www.sidefx.com and
run it. You will see various hangs almost immediately upon running
'houdini'.

I can help with all manner of debugging; I just don't understand X (and
in particular, libx11 and XCB) enough to do this myself.

-- System Information:
Debian Release: lenny/sid
  APT prefers unstable
  APT policy: (500, 'unstable'), (1, 'experimental')
Architecture: amd64 (x86_64)

Kernel: Linux 2.6.22-3-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_CA.UTF-8, LC_CTYPE=en_CA.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ash

Versions of packages libx11-6 depends on:
ii  libc6                         2.7-6      GNU C Library: Shared libraries
ii  libx11-data                   2:1.0.3-7  X11 client-side library
ii  libxcb-xlib0                  1.1-1      X C Binding, Xlib/XCB interface li
ii  libxcb1                       1.1-1      X C Binding
ii  x11-common                    1:7.3+10   X Window System (X.Org) infrastruc

libx11-6 recommends no packages.

-- no debconf information



Reply to: